The Kid Stays In The Picture traces the meteoric rise, fall and rise again of legendary Hollywood producer Robert Evans. The producer of The Godfather (1972) and Chinatown (1974), Evans' career faltered in the early 80s thanks to a cocaine bust and his rumoured involvement in a murder. This documentary, adapted from his best selling autobiography, chronicles his life, his loves (with the likes of Ava Gardner, Grace Kelly, Lana Turner, Ali Macgraw, and Raquel Welch) and friendships (Warren Beatty, Jack Nicholson, Roman Polanski, Henry Kissinger and Dustin Hoffman).

This documentary is mainly composed of still images, with a couple of interview clips thrown in for extra measure. Hard to even class it as a moving picture, but surprisingly effective to say the least.

Legendary Hollywood producer Robert Evans life is an interesting enough subject, and he's a fantastic storyteller, but what this film lacks is commentary from any of the numerous stars and celebrities accompanying Evans on his journey. There's not a single thing here to back up his tales.
